Premier Matahbatha must take special leave pending the HAWKS investigation

The Democratic Alliance (DA) in Limpopo notes with concern that the Special Investigation Unit (HAWKS) yesterday confirmed an investigation into Limpopo Premier, Stan Mathabatha.

The DA has hitherto abstained from commenting on the allegations made by NEHAWU on criminal activities in the Office of the Premier, but the confirmation by the HAWKS has changed our course.

The allegations are based on Premier Matahabatha’s lack of acting against tender irregularities and allegations of malfeasance  in his office.

We call on Premier Mathabatha to be transparent and to disclose all companies that were awarded contracts by his office for the last 3 years, including their board of directors, value of each contracts, the service being provided and the status of the contracts.

This information pertains to the use of public money in the highest office in the province and it should be easily accessible for scrutiny.

The Premier’s reluctance to hold officials in his office to account is cause for concern.

The PPE tenders from March to June 2020 in Limpopo amount to R728 886 272 and is fraught with corruption allegations.

Premier Mathabatha did request the HAWKS to investigate the Departments of Health, Education and Cooperative Governance, who received the lion share of the Covid 19 procurement allocation.

There is no doubt that, with the confirmation of an investigation into the Premier, there is a clear conflict of interest which has the potential to derail the investigations into the PPE looting.

The DA calls on Premier Mathabatha to protect the integrity of his office and to go on special leave until the investigation against him is finalised.
